The following is a glossary of traditional English-language terms used in the three overarching cue sports disciplines: carom billiards referring to the various carom games played on a billiard table without pockets; pool, which denotes a host of games played on a table with six pockets; and snooker, played on a large pocket table, and which has a sport culture unto itself distinct from pool. A pocket billiards table has six pockets-one at each corner of the table (corner pockets) and one at the midpoint of each of the longer sides (side pockets or middle pockets). Solid balls are entirely colored, while striped balls have a single colorful strip across them. Balls 9-15 have a stripe of color, in which the number is highlighted in a circle. The tables may or may not have pockets. Pocketless, or carom, billiards tables have, as the name suggests, no pockets.
